New dates have been set for the Watford Observer Fourteen14 Plate semi-finals after both games were called off earlier today.
Tomorrow's clash between Watford Grammar School for Boys and Aldenham at Chipperfield Clarendon was the first to be postponed, before tonight's other semi-final between Watford Town B and Rickmansworth at Abbots Langley also suffered the same fate.
The latter has been rearranged for Tuesday, while following numerous conversations both Watford Grammar and Aldenham have agreed to play their rearranged tie at the Rickmansworth Road school next Thursday (July 19).
Both matches though, will start at the earlier time of 6pm because of potential concerns about the light later in the evening.
As a result of these latest weather-enforced changes, the Plate final - rearranged for Tuesday - will have to be put back again.
Both Shield semi-finals were again postponed earlier this week but the match between Leverstock Green and Langleybury A has been rescheduled for Tuesday at Watford Town, also with a 6pm start.
It is hoped the other last-four clash, with Watford Town A meeting West Herts, can also finally take place early next week, allowing for the final to be played at Chipperfield Clarendon on July 19.
